What version of Go are you using (go version)?

go version go1.12 linux/amd64

What did you do?

package main

import (
	"fmt"
)


type S struct {}

func (S) M(n int) {
	fmt.Println(n)
}

type T struct {
	*S
}

type I interface {
	M(n int)
}


func foo() {
	var v = &T{}
	var i I = v
	f := i.M // ok
	v.S = &S{}
	f(111) // 111
}

func bar() {
	var v = &T{}
	f := v.M // panic
	v.S = &S{}
	f(111)
}

func main() {
	foo()
	bar()
}

What did you expect to see?

Same behavior

What did you see instead?

Different behaviors.

In the case f := v.M we check for a nil pointer at the point where we create the method value. We do this because checking for the nil pointer when the method value is invoked leads to a confusing backtrace. In the case f := i.M we check that i is not nil, but we do not check that the value itself contains a nil pointer.

So this is working as expected, in order to avoid a nil dereference in a generated wrapper function, but, you're right, it's not completely consistent.

If we document something, it would be a change to the language spec saying that you can not create a method value of a value method of a nil pointer, and you can not create a method value of a promoted method of an embedded pointer if the pointer is nil. To put it another way, all nil checks are done when the method value is created, not when it is invoked.

For interface types, you can not create a value method if the interface value is nil. However, we do not check anything about the value stored in the interface value, and I'm not sure that we can.

I think this is clear specify in the spec for this behavior:

As with selectors, a reference to a non-interface method with a value receiver using a pointer will automatically dereference that pointer: pt.Mv is equivalent to (*pt).Mv.

As with method calls, a reference to a non-interface method with a pointer receiver using an addressable value will automatically take the address of that value: t.Mp is equivalent to (&t).Mp.
